Output b368995d39556c0a2c6bec99d53f4902e8ea9d68c6d2e652ea9742635d4a2ac4:0

value
1071670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83fd06e9bc6a50929b97b872d94042336779bf0b OP_EQUAL
address
3DiuZJEgdtyaHRJDsFuBdo7JE2bv6cQpKy
transaction
b368995d39556c0a2c6bec99d53f4902e8ea9d68c6d2e652ea9742635d4a2ac4
spent
true